The Problem with Cutoffs

Today's podcast discusses key issues when we employ discrete, black and white thinking in medicine. It's an audio digest of the zentensivist.com post of the same name. 


Key topics:

  • what we can learn from statisticians about clinical reasoning
  • how patients across a threshold can have more in common than with those in their group
  • how to avoid cutting off clinical reasoning
